Dr. Ravi at Folsom Spine offers both minimally invasive anterior cervical fusions and open procedures. What is an anterior cervical fusion? If you experience relentless arm, leg, neck or lower back pain, paralysis or weakness in the limbs, perhaps you should know. For those who suffer degenerative problems in the spine, such as degenerative disc disease, an anterior cervical fusion can limit pain in the neck, back and extremities while eliminating or lessening other symptoms... including tingling, weakness and even paralysis. During the procedure, one or more cervical discs are removed and replaced with a titanium spacer. Learn more about anterior cervical fusions at www.folsomspine.com

Do you suffer from back and leg pain? A microdiscectomy could help! Also known as a microdecompresion, a microdiscectomy is a minimally invasive spinal procedure completed to alleviate severe back pain by taking pressure off of nerves in the spine. During the procedure, a surgeon makes a small incision in the back and removes the intervertabral disc putting pressure on the spine. By removing the disc, relief is achieved, and because the procedure is minimally invasive patient...s do not endure long, painful recoveries.
